Where Do These Correlations Come From? (Hint: It’s Not Just The USD!)

In real markets, price movements rarely happen in a vacuum. When we look at USD/AUD, your knee-jerk thought might be “if the US Dollar strengthens everywhere, USD/AUD must go up too, right?” Well, yes and no. There are layers beneath the surface. Let’s break that open using both personal trading experience and some data-backed context.

Finding Real Correlations: A Step-By-Step, Real-Life Process

  1. Pull up historical charts. Personally, I use TradingView (https://www.tradingview.com/), but Bloomberg Terminal or Yahoo Finance ( will also work. I admit, the first few months I had absolutely no clue how to overlay pairs—for context, I once spent 5 minutes trying to plot USD/JPY on an AUD/USD chart, before realizing “duh, I just need ‘compare’!” Screenshot below shows what I finally figured out:
    TradingView overlay USD/AUD, USD/JPY, EUR/USD
  2. Calculate correlation coefficients. If you’re into Excel, you can use the =CORREL() formula, but most platforms let you do it graphically. For example, if you run a daily 90-day rolling correlation on TradingView between USD/AUD and USD/JPY, you'll find (on most non-crisis periods) the coefficient is often between +0.40 and +0.70—but not always! Investopedia’s explainer is pretty friendly for beginners.

Why is this? Here’s what I noticed in daily practice: Correlation is driven by more than the US Dollar. For USD/AUD vs. USD/JPY for example:

  • USD/AUD is often swayed by China’s commodity demand and Australia’s trade balance, not just US data.
  • USD/JPY, on the other hand, responds more sharply to US rate decisions, Japanese government intervention rumors, and global risk sentiment (“risk-on” and “risk-off”).
So while both have “USD” upfront, their drivers frequently diverge—creating breakdowns in correlation when, say, iron ore prices spike or the Bank of Japan surprises markets.

A Real-World Divergence: When Theory Meets Messy Reality

Let me share a trade from last year. I was holding a USD/AUD long position around a US jobs report. Textbook logic suggested all USD pairs should pop together if jobs beat estimates. But—instead—USD/JPY shot up 1% in fifteen minutes, while USD/AUD barely moved, then faded lower. Turns out, Australia had just posted a blockbuster trade surplus, and Chinese data came out positive, offsetting USD strength completely.

This isn’t just my experience. BIS data shows cross-currency correlations for majors like AUD, JPY, and EUR shift based on which local economies or commodities are in focus. This means your “USD” pairs can move out of sync fast.

Expert trader Paul Scott, in a 2022 interview for FXStreet, summed it up bluntly: “If you trade USD/AUD on the same logic as USD/EUR or USD/JPY, you’ll get whiplash. Look at the base country’s story—Australia is a commodity play; Japan is all about monetary policy and safe havens.”

What I Messed Up: Learning It The Hard Way

Here’s my favorite humbling moment. Early on, I programmed my trading bot to short AUD/USD whenever USD/JPY’s RSI hit 70. Great in theory, but… it tanked fast during an RBA (Reserve Bank of Australia) emergency rate cut. Yen didn’t care; Aussie dollar collapsed. My “correlation” had missed the fact that at the end of the day, AUD is still, well, AUD.

Wrapping Up: Practical Teachings and Next Steps

So, does USD/AUD always move together with USD/JPY, EUR/USD, or the rest? Not really. There’s correlation—sometimes quite strong, especially during global USD sentiment waves or crises—but it’s constantly shifting depending on what matters most to each currency's home economy.
